Leon Aland Family Foundation is a private foundation focused on Philanthropy, Voluntarism & Grantmaking, based in BIRMINGHAM, AL. IRS filing data is available from 2020 through 2024. As of 2024, the organization holds $804K in total assets. In 2024, it awarded 7 grants totaling $57K. Net investment income was $40K.

Financial History
Multi-year comparison from IRS filings
| Metric | 2024 | 2023 | 2022 |
|---|---|---|---|
| Total Assets | $804,148 | $820,398 | $882,494 |
| Revenue | $52,175 | $11,716 | $32,222 |
| Expenses | $69,310 | $73,332 | $64,723 |
| Qualifying Distributions | $57,000 | $55,000 | $55,000 |
| Net Investment Income | $39,865 | $16,273 | $22,252 |
| Distributable Amount | $41,477 | $41,208 | $44,628 |

Giving History
Grant recipients and amounts by year
Among its reported 2024 grants, the largest include Birmingham Holocaust Education Center ($10,000), Birmingham Zoo ($10,000), Choice ($9,000).
| Recipient | Purpose | Amount |
|---|---|---|
| BIRMINGHAM CHILDREN'S THEATRE BIRMINGHAM, AL | TO EDUCATE, ENTERTAIN AND ENRICH THE LIVES OF CHILDREN THROUGH THE MAGIC OF PROFESSIONAL THEATRE. | $5,000 |
| BIRMINGHAM CIVIL RIGHTS INSTITUTE BIRMINGHAM, AL | SUPPORT THE MISSION TO ENLIGHTEN EACH GENERATION ON CIVIL AND HUMAN RIGHTS BY EXPLORING OUR COMMON PAST AND WORKING TOGETHER IN THE PRESENT TO BUILD A BETTER FUTURE. | $8,000 |
| BIRMINGHAM HOLOCAUST EDUCATION CENTER BIRMINGHAM, AL | TO KEEP THE HOLOCAUST ALIVE IN THE MINDS OF BIRMINGHAM AND ALABAMA CITIZENS, SO THAT ITS TYPE OF HORROR WILL NEVER BE REPEATED. | $10,000 |
| BIRMINGHAM ZOO BIRMINGHAM, AL | INSPIRING PASSION TO CONSERVE THE NATURAL WORLD. | $10,000 |
| CHOICE UNIONTOWN, AL | TO CREATE COLLABORATIVE PARTNERSHIPS TO ENSURE YOUTH HAVE ACCESS TO RESOURCES THAT PROVIDE QUALITY PROGRAMS, ACTIVITIES, AND SERVICES. | $9,000 |
| LIFESOURCE INC DECATUR, AL | SERVING THOSE IN THE CRIMINAL JUSTICE SYSTEM WHO STRUGGLE WITH ADDICTION, WITH THE INTENTION OF MOTIVATING POSITIVE AND PERMANENT LIFE CHANGE, AND THE GOAL OF HELPING THEM BECOME CONTRIBUTING MEMBERS OF SOCIETY AT HOME, IN THE WORKPLACE, AND IN THE COMMUNITY. | $7,000 |
| MCWANE SCIENCE CENTER BIRMINGHAM, AL | SCHOLARSHIP EXPENSES | $8,000 |
